Cost to Own a Home in Georgiana, Alabama
A $58,000 home here costs
$625per month, all in — with 20% down at today's 6.66% 30-year fixed rate.
A standard mortgage calculator would have told you $298. The real number is $327 higher every month — 110% more than the payment most buyers budget for.

The weather behind that power bill
Georgiana sits in Butler County, which averages a high of 92.4°F in its hottest month and a low of 36.9°F in its coldest, with 55.24" of precipitation a year and 29% of it in a single three-month stretch. That climate drives 2,364 cooling and 1,952 heating degree days, which is what sets the $151 electricity line above.

Common questions
How much does it cost to own a home in Georgiana?
A $58,000 home in Georgiana, Alabama costs approximately $625 per month with 20% down at 6.66%. That is $298 principal and interest, $20 property tax, $40 homeowners insurance, $219 utilities and $48 set aside for maintenance.
What is the property tax rate in Georgiana?
Georgiana has an effective property tax rate of 0.418%, based on a median home value of $57,900 and median real estate taxes of $242. That is higher than the Butler County average of 0.343%.
What is the average home price in Georgiana?
The median owner-occupied home value in Georgiana, Alabama is $57,900, against $99,700 across Butler County.
Is it cheaper to rent or buy in Georgiana?
Median gross rent in Georgiana is $613 a month, against $625 to own the median home all in. Renting costs less month to month here, though renting builds no equity.
